The problem we are suffering downstream is the following: http://bugs.gentoo.org/show_bug.cgi?id=3D305063#c5 In summary, the same files are being *installed* with --with-phonebook=3Debook and --with-phonebook=3Ddummy (in both cases, phonebook files are not being installed at all). A $PREFIX/lib/obex/plugins directory is created but nothing is installed on it. Another problem is that, when passing --without-phonebook to configure, build fails with: $ make make --no-print-directory all-am CC gdbus/mainloop.o CC gdbus/object.o CC gdbus/watch.o CC plugins/filesystem.o CC plugins/opp.o CC plugins/ftp.o CC plugins/pbap.o CC plugins/syncevolution.o CC src/main.o GEN src/builtin.h CC src/plugin.o CC src/logging.o CC src/btio.o CC src/manager.o CC src/obex.o CC src/bluetooth.o CC src/mimetype.o CC src/service.o make[1]: *** No rule to make target `plugins/phonebook-no.c', needed by `plugins/phonebook.c'.
